Summary
The INSA C coping is a structural and functional element that plays a key role in protecting and finishing infrastructures such as bridges and elevated passages.
Its design allows it to cover bridge decks, providing both an aesthetic and functional solution. Additionally, it serves as a protective barrier for sensitive installations such as water, gas, or electricity pipes, shielding them from external factors like moisture, corrosion, or mechanical impacts.
Thanks to its robustness and versatility, the INSA C coping helps extend the service life of infrastructures, ensuring their safety and operational efficiency over time.
